As above, what is the benefit of having a back plate, does it really help cool down your card?
I have a GTX570 and am waiting for the arctic cooling Xtreme Plus to be delivered so i can install it, would the evga back plate help make the aftermarket cooler not bend the card so much? I know the 580 backplate fits the 570 card.

Thanks.
 
Not really cooling.


It does help with bending, as mentioned, and it helps protect the backside PCB from any physical damage.

Protects the PCB, also some of the pins on the back of the PCB can be quite sharp, so it protects you from them as well. And finally provides support should you be using an aftermarket cooler
